Oh, I do like Chicken Soup for the Cat Lover's Soul too. It's a decent food. Both Nutro and Chicken Soup are quite a bit better for our cats than Purina Cat Chow.

The other thing I want to mention to the OP, is that make sure you're including wet food as part of their diet...this can often prevent future urinary troubles. My motto is this: Dry food - go premium. Wet food - can squeak by with a cheaper brand, as long as real meat is still included in the first 5 ingredients. My suggestion would be to buy Nutro Natural dry food, supplement with some Nutro wet 2-3 times a week, and also, don't shy away from Meow Mix POUCHES. Meow Mix dry is awful, but the pouches contain a lot of real meat listed as the #1 source of protein. They are highly palatable to cats, and are surprisingly healthy. The other option, is to look at a a couple of the flavors from Fancy Feast...they're not too bad in terms of ingredients, if you can believe it.
